# Zambia’s ministry of Tourism has reaffirmed its commitment to combating wildlife crime through the ongoing Worth More Alive campaign. The campaign has been developed as a response to the rising threat of wildlife trafficking, particularly through the country’s international airports. Efforts under the campaign include establishing a wildlife crime hotline and installing life-size sculptures of endangered species at Kenneth Kaunda International Airport. Zambia’s iconic and endangered wildlife, including elephants, pangolins, rhinos and big cats, are integral to the country’s ecological balance.
